Abstract

Data on relative biological effect (RBE) for several mammalian responses were converted into yields per trajectory passing. The relation between this yield and the linear energy transfer (LET) was analyzed using weak assumptions of target theory. The analysis showed that the data.presented cannot be fitted with any of the simple models of radiation action: single ionization, effective tail, and unlimited diffusion. The mechanism involved must be of a mixed type. A possible mechanism is proposed. It emphasizes the importance of healing of elementary structures rather than the occurrence of primary damage.
